Output 58db7ae14f26a9dc8d495feb684b74aa53bb4360baea9359b871ac8a08019812:0

value
2597628
script pubkey
OP_0 OP_PUSHBYTES_20 7c73644cb57b0fd3070f152cd869f1ba5c8b707a
address
bc1q03ekgn940v8axpc0z5kds603hfwgkur63m964f
transaction
58db7ae14f26a9dc8d495feb684b74aa53bb4360baea9359b871ac8a08019812
spent
true